Estimation of Driver's State While Automatic Driving Using Seat Surface Pressure

Abstract

Automation level 3 of an automobile is an automatic operation in the normal state;, however, the operation is switched to the driver when it is determined that operation of the system is difficult to continue. In previous study, there were cases where automatic operation cannot be smoothly switched from manual operation owing to motion other than driving, or a decrease in arousal level during automatic operation. It is considered that estimating the condition of the driver can support smooth switching. In this study, we estimated the state of the driver while automatic driving using seat surface pressure. Results indicate that the estimation was approximately 100% in the individual evaluation and 78.4% in the overall evaluation using machine learning. This suggests that it is possible to estimate the driver's state while automatic driving.
